跳至主要內容
  • Hostloc 空間訪問刷分
  • 售賣場
  • 廣告位
  • 賣站?

4563博客

全新的繁體中文 WordPress 網站
  • 首頁
  • 2020 年,如何编程控制马达?以及,如果一个不会编程的人想学如何控制马达,应该学什么?
未分類
5 5 月 2020

2020 年,如何编程控制马达?以及,如果一个不会编程的人想学如何控制马达,应该学什么?

2020 年,如何编程控制马达?以及,如果一个不会编程的人想学如何控制马达,应该学什么?

資深大佬 : RtIHZ 1

帮一个搞装置艺术的朋友问的,她说她想学编程,追问之下才说只是想“控制马达”(并运用到她的作品中去,我猜)。

关于编程控制马达,我只知道 arduino 可以。但我自己动手做这个已经是十年前了。所以想求助一下 V2,有没有什么更好的方案?

以及如果她的目的仅仅是编程控制马达的话,应该如何学习编程呢(如何最小化要学习的内容)?我觉得,学习一下 if for while 之类的基本语句 应该就差不多了吧。

谢谢各位

大佬有話說 (31)

  • 資深大佬 : GentleSadness

    歪个,你这个手机震动让我浮想翩翩,真不是小情侣间开车吗

  • 主 資深大佬 : RtIHZ

    @GentleSadness 指的是电动机,不是手机震动马达

  • 資深大佬 : pod

    可变电阻?

  • 資深大佬 : misaka19000

    树莓派

  • 資深大佬 : tetora

    感觉你朋友想学的是控制舵机

  • 資深大佬 : chinvo

    Arduino + 舵机 /电机 驱动板 最好入门

    语法也只需要 C 语言基础语法

    如果要深入就要研究指令集, 寄存器, 时钟, 机器周期, 通信协议, 电机拖动什么的了

  • 資深大佬 : jworg

    这个问题建议你去 tb 问卖东西的商家,为了卖出东西,会扔给一堆教程链接的

  • 資深大佬 : murmur

    控制的是马达还是步进电机?

  • 資深大佬 : dingdong

    给钱外包实现

  • 資深大佬 : nutting

    乐高机器人

  • 資深大佬 : TaylorJack123

    乐高或者小米那个可编程玩具车,都是控制马达,而且都是图形化编程

  • 資深大佬 : systemcall

    实现的不算特别复杂建议直接学 Arduino,用 c 写
    那些所谓的图形化编程稍微复杂点的东西就很麻烦了,没 c 直观
    最好用 vscode 写,自己搭建好环境,arduino ide 太烂了,感觉像是在拿记事本写程序

  • 資深大佬 : zaiyund

    如果只要马达转 用有刷直流电机
    如果严格要求马达转的圈数 用步进电机
    如果是控制转的角度 用舵机
    arduino 应该最方便,虽然我也没用过。如果觉得做不好,可以出钱找人

  • 資深大佬 : bibizhang

    TouchDesigner 可以吗

  • 資深大佬 : c416593819

    Arduino 玩具遥控车
    照这个学估计可以,需要了解写 c 语言

  • 資深大佬 : marcong95

    如果成本、体积可以接受的话,乐高 EV3 了解一下。不可以的话还是只能 arduino 了,或者 micropython 啥的?

  • 資深大佬 : yeqizhang

    树莓派,Python 库用起来就是了……

  • 資深大佬 : Phariel

    你这位朋友有孩子没?有孩子的话让孩子去上各种少儿编程班 硬件积木的这种 家长偷偷学一下就会了

  • 資深大佬 : colinrat

    马达控制是嵌入式开发中门槛比较高的,建议系统性的学习

  • 資深大佬 : zaiyund

    再写一点 需要学点 python/JS 比 C 简单,买一个移植了 python/JS 解释器的开源硬件,比搞树莓派简单,开源硬件插到电脑上 直接就是一个 u 盘 把代码复制进去就行,都不用下载的。最后 做个电机的驱动电路。这又是软件又是硬件的,如果只做一次两次 不如出去找人

  • 資深大佬 : fengmumu

    推荐树莓派,可以简单了解一下 python,然后看看点击咋控制,搞个驱动模块,接好线,控制一下输出就好了,无非就是 pwa 那一套,不要理上的说用 c,咩有必要,玩票性质的 不用搞那么多的,
    动手能力好点的 零基础三四天就可以了 不难的,注意不要直接接,树莓派的 io 口电流很弱的

  • 資深大佬 : Trim21

    步进电机的话树莓派 gpio 和 python 就行

  • 資深大佬 : yyang179

    Arduino IDE 安装好后,自带了 Stepper 库用于控制步进电机,需要买个电机和驱动板,连下线就可以转起来了,很方便的。

  • 資深大佬 : imgk

    树莓派+python 最简单

  • 資深大佬 : Takamine

    装个 Keil,买个开发板。:doge:

  • 資深大佬 : locoz

    都是封装好的东西,没啥难度,用树莓派直接调 GPIO 库就好了。比如直流电机就设个 1 就能转、0 就能停,步进电机调用一次动一下、高频调用就转起来了,加上其他业务代码就完事。

  • 資深大佬 : elfive

    看你是什么电机,有的可调速的可能是 PWM 信号调速,有的是电压调速,两个都很简单,前者可以暴力 TTL 模拟,后者 D-A 转换一个芯片就能搞定。

  • 資深大佬 : hoyixi

    用 API 或者指令就可以控制,简单的很;即使没公开提供,你也可以 hack

  • 資深大佬 : lloovve

    简单 pwm 复杂步进电机,再复杂伺服电机,在复杂无感无刷 foc

  • 資深大佬 : mason961125

    @Takamine #24 先出 3W 授权费(

  • 資深大佬 : sw2hw

    凭本人多年的工作经验和外包的经历,我想你的朋友可能是想“控制马达驱动器“—这个只需要做好软件接口即可,里面的实现细节恐怕不是你的朋友感兴趣的,也没必要知道。

文章導覽

上一篇文章
下一篇文章

AD

其他操作

  • 登入
  • 訂閱網站內容的資訊提供
  • 訂閱留言的資訊提供
  • WordPress.org 台灣繁體中文

51la

4563博客

全新的繁體中文 WordPress 網站
返回頂端
本站採用 WordPress 建置 | 佈景主題採用 GretaThemes 所設計的 Memory
4563博客
  • Hostloc 空間訪問刷分
  • 售賣場
  • 廣告位
  • 賣站?
在這裡新增小工具